Read full article: Forever 21 files for bankruptcyGetty Images(CNN) - Forever 21, the teenage clothing emporium that rode America's mall boom and bust, said on Sunday that it fil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y. Forever 21 is the latest retailer to collapse amid the ascendancy of online shopping that has cut foot traffic to malls and brick-and-mortar stores. Forever 21 was founded in 1984 in a small Los Angeles store by South Korean immigrants Do Won Chang and his wife, Jin Sook. Read full article: Ariana Grande sues Forever 21 over ads featuring 'look-alike model'Getty Images/Dave HoganLOS ANGELES - Ariana Grande has a problem with Forever 21. The documents allege Forever 21 and Riley Rose published at least 30 unauthorized images and videos "misappropriating Ms. Grande's name, image, likeness and music in order to create the false perception of her endorsement." The images showcased in the lawsuit no longer appear to be on Forever 21's Instagram, Twitter or Facebook pages. The suit claims Forever 21 left some of the unauthorized posts up until at least April 17, 2019, despite requests beginning in February that all of them be removed. Read full article: Forever 21 reportedly preparing to file for bankruptcyGetty Images(CNN) - Teen clothing retailer Forever 21 is preparing for a potential bankruptcy filing, according to several published reports. Forever 21, which is privately held, has more than 800 stores in 57 countries. And while many retailers have been paring back their network of stores in recent years, Forever 21 was adding stores as recently as 2016. But Forever 21 is still owned by its founders, Do Won and Jin Sook Chang.
